Derby, a historic city in the UK's East Midlands, offers a rich and diverse blend of heritage, industry, and culture. Derby's foundation dates back to Roman times, and the region has seen a succession of occupants, including the Danes, Saxons, and Normans. The city contains remnants of its Roman past at Little Chester and was established as a market town, eventually growing into an industrial powerhouse. The manufacture of silk and porcelain has been prominent in Derby since the 18th century, with Royal Crown Derby's fine bone china remaining world-renowned to this day. Derby's industrial prowess also extended to various sectors, including canals and later railways, making it a crucial transport hub. In more recent times, Derby has continued to thrive in industries like rail and aerospace while launching successful endeavors in education, tourism, and retail.
